Galen Dolkas work experience
A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.
Crew Lead/ Field Biologist
CurrentMonitor California condor (Gymnogyps californianus) and golden eagle (Aquila crysaetos) activity in real-time to prevent bird strikes to wind turbines. Applying good judgment to determine if/when turbines are powered down based on bird trajectory and knowledge of avian behaviors related to migration and foraging. Manage field technicians to ensure safety.
Field Biology Technician
- Conducted field survey to assess impact of tree thinning on breeding success of pinyon-juniper woodland obligate bird species (including juniper titmouse (Baeolophus ridgwayii), bewick's wren (Thryomanes bewickii), and.

- Surveyed plants, animals & soil to assess impact of grazing on the rangeland health throughout southeast New Mexico. Species of interest include lesser prairie-chicken (Tympanuchus pallidicinctus), soaptree yucca.
Wildlife Volunteer
Surveyed and monitored changes in local bird populations throughout Ft. Stanton-Snowy River Cave National Conservation Area. Became proficient with range finder, transects, listening posts & estimating distance to birds.
Student Researcher
Conducted research on the structure of raptor feathers and the ways that they vary with regard to a suit of ecological and morphological factors.
